INTERPOL uncovers over 1,300 servers used as launchpads

INTERPOL, the largest international police organization, has recently completed a major operation targeting the infrastructure behind malicious activities such as phishing, malware, and ransomware attacks. This operation, named “Synergia,” spanned over three months from September to November 2023 and involved the collaboration of 60 law enforcement agencies across more than 50 countries.

The primary aim of this global operation was to combat complex and cross-border criminal activities using advanced technical tools and methodologies for investigations and interventions. The operation successfully identified 1,300 suspicious websites and servers linked to cybercrime, with 70% of these servers being taken down, thereby disrupting their operations. Additionally, 31 individuals were arrested, and 70 more suspects were identified as part of the operation.

One of the significant aspects of Operation “Synergia” was the participation of countries across continents, demonstrating a global effort to combat cybercrime. From Europe and Asia to Africa and South America, the operation saw collaboration on an international scale.

Furthermore, the operation involved conducting house searches and seizures of equipment, as well as collaboration with private sector partners. Tech giants like Kaspersky and TrendMicro provided crucial intelligence and support, further strengthening the efforts of law enforcement agencies.

Assistant Director “Bernardo Pillot” at INTERPOL Cyber Crime expressed satisfaction with the results of the operation, emphasizing the collective efforts of multiple countries and partners. According to Pillot, the operation’s outcomes demonstrate a steadfast commitment to safeguarding the digital space. By dismantling the infrastructure behind phishing, banking malware, and ransomware attacks, the operation has brought the digital ecosystems one step closer to being protected, offering a safer and more secure online experience for all.
